an 80-kg man is sitting on the right side of the plank, 1.25m away from the fulcrum. While on the left side of the plank, a 30-kg girl and a 20-kg boy are both seated 2.00 and 1.75m away from the fulcrum, respectively. A mystery object C is also placed on the left side of the plank with a lever arm of 1.0m. To make the system in equilibrium, another mystery object A is placed on the right side of the plank, 0.5m away from the fulcrum.  Use the second condition for equilibrium to find the Torques of objects A and C.
